How Should I Store Dry Lentils? Dry lentils are versatile legumes that can be stored for extended periods with proper care. To ensure optimal preservation, it’s crucial to keep them in a cool, dry place. An ideal storage environment is a pantry or cupboard with temperatures below 70 degrees Fahrenheit and humidity levels below 50%.[…]

Where did almond roca originate? Almond Roca, the renowned confectionery delight, has a rich history dating back to the early 1920s in Tacoma, Washington. The origin of this delectable treat is attributed to Brown & Haley, a confectionery company founded by Harry Brown and John Haley in 1912. The company began experimenting with various sweets,[…]
